Overmarine founder and president dies

Giuseppe Balducci, founder and president of Overmarine Group has died.

Giuseppe was born in Limite sull’Arno in 1937 and began his career in the marine industry aged only 16 as an electrician in the Picchiotti shipyard where he worked until 1971 when the Viareggio-based boat builder declared bankruptcy.

In the same year, Giuseppe decided to set up his own business, Elettromare, which continues to manufacture marine electrical systems.

Even in its early days, Elettromare was known as a pioneering company that made electrical panels and systems for boats using cutting-edge equipment.

As part of his business activity, Giuseppe Balducci travelled extensively around Italy and the United States.

His travels led him to see first-hand how boat building was evolving, moving from the use of wood to that of fibreglass and this inspired him to open a factory in Massarosa (Lucca) for the construction of fibreglass yachts.

During the 1980s, Giuseppe’s vision proved to be far[1]sighted and the factory soon began to be used by boat builders for the construction of their hulls.

Shortly afterwards, Overmarine was established, specialising in the construction of fast maxi-open yachts with an unmistakable, timeless style.

World leader

The company rapidly became a world leader in the construction of vessels in this segment with around 85 units of the first maxi-open model, the Mangusta 80, sold in the following years.

In a statement, Overmarine Group said the company today is the result of the unfaltering enthusiasm of a man who believed in a great dream.

Giuseppe was also convinced of Viareggio’s potential and was one of the founding partners of two companies actively operating in the port of Viareggio, Udina and ArPeCa.

He also believed in keeping active and involved in the Overmarine Group, personally overseeing the construction of a new manufacturing plant in Pisa, which will be officially opened later this month.

“Giuseppe will always be remembered as a reserved man, with a subtle sense of humour and a great love for his wife Bruna, his children Maurizio and Katia, his beloved granddaughters, and all his employees, who, together with him, have built vessels that have become icons in the marine industry,” said a company spokesperson.

“This is the way the entire Overmarine team want to remember him, as they express their profound gratitude to him and extend their thoughts and condolences to the Balducci family.”
